How to Increase Stamina Naturally: Diet and Fitness Tips

Dr. Priyanka Marakini

July 22, 2022

Stamina is the energy and strength you possess. It allows you to endure long periods of the mental and physical toll. How to increase stamina? It is a question many people ask whether they are an athlete or a non–athlete.

The key point in answering the question is an amalgamation of diet, exercise and a healthy lifestyle.

For starters, it is common to feel fatigued after a long day at work or in the gym. If you know the simple ways to increase your stamina, you can decrease exhaustion. Higher stamina levels will allow you to go harder if your focus is to get fit. It will help you increase the number of reps for each exercise. And it won’t be long before you reach your fitness goals.

Table of Contents

Simple Ways to Increase Stamina

You are already aware of the benefits of having excellent stamina. Now, the question is how you can improve it? Are there techniques you can follow which will help you do it?

It is not that difficult. You can make some changes in your daily life which will help you increase your stamina. One way is to eat the right food, which gives your body all the energy it needs. Rather than having one or two huge meals, break it down into small ones. Also, ensure that you consume nutritious snacks between meals. It will help you last through the day.

If you are looking for long term techniques to increase stamina, exercise is the way to go. You can make your body improve oxygen supply by focusing on activities that work on your lungs and heart. The benefit is that your stamina will start to increase. While the changes are gradual, they will make a massive difference in the long run.

Although one key to increasing stamina is staying active, you should also remember to rest. When you get a good night’s sleep, you will have higher energy levels. It will improve your vigour. You also need to refrain from smoking or consuming alcohol regularly. It is detrimental to your health and affects your stamina.

Exercises to Increase Stamina

One of the best ways to increase your stamina is to indulge in exercise and physical activities. However, before you start, you should know how much physical activity you need for improving your energy levels. As an adult, you need to get at least 2½ hours (150 minutes) of exercise every week.

You can break this down into short bouts of activity called ‘snacktivity’– thirty minutes of physical activities for five days every week. You should also focus on performing these exercises for longer before increasing their intensity.

1. Bench Press

Strength training is crucial when it comes to increasing stamina. Not only does it increase your muscle mass, but it also improves endurance. You need to lift your weights with high intensity so that your energy levels continue to rise over time.

The bench press is an excellent workout for your whole body. You need to head to the gym to perform this activity.

Bench Press: The Right Way

  • Lie down on the bench and ensure your eyes are below the bar. 
  • Squeeze your shoulder blades while lifting your chest. 
  • The next step is to hold the bar at a width that keeps your arms straight. Next, ensure your thumbs are around the bar for a proper grip. It should be within the heel of your palm. It gives excellent support. 
  • Take a huge breath, remove the bar from the rack while keeping your arms straight. 
  • Bring it down to mid-chest while keeping the elbows at 75°. 
  • Hold your breath for at least a second before raising it above the shoulders. 
  • Once the bar is on top, lock the elbows and breathe. 
  • Do five reps of this exercise every week for best results.

2. Cycling

If you are looking for exercises to increase your stamina, cycling is excellent. It is a cardio workout. You will improve your endurance in the long run. The trick is to go at the same pace for long-distance. It has a positive impact on your stamina.

If you are doing this in the gym, ensure your back is straight. While squeezing your shoulder blades, go slow for at least five minutes before increasing your speed gradually.

3. Jumping Jacks

Jumping Jack is the best exercise to increase stamina at home. It is a simple full-body cardio workout that works your muscles, lungs, and heart. 

  • Stand straight, with the arms beside you, while keeping the legs together.
  • Jump and spread the legs at a distance equal to the width of your shoulders. 
  • At the same time, stretch the arms till it goes over your head. 
  • Jump again and return to the starting position. Do at least ten reps of this exercise in every set  (two sets minimum).

4. Push-ups

Although it is a simple exercise, it is excellent to increase stamina. You can do it at home, in the gym or in the garden.

  • You need to lie down on the floor and lift your body until your arms become straight. 
  • While on the ground, make sure the palms are close to the chest.
  • As you rise, the arms should be at a distance more significant than the width of your shoulders. 
  • Go down till your elbows are 90° or your chest touches the floor. 
  • Return to the starting position, which completes one rep. 
  • You need to do a minimum of 10 reps each in two sets at least three times a week.

5. Stair Climb

If you are thinking about increasing running stamina, climbing stairs is the best exercise. Not only does it improve your power and strength, but it also focuses on your endurance.

Are you wondering why you are out of breath faster when you have to climb up a hill? Unlike a flat surface, an inclined one increases your heart rate. As a result, you have to take more significant amounts of oxygen. Make sure you cover at least four flights of stairs (up and down) for six days every week.

6. Swimming

How to increase stamina for exercise is one question everyone asks their trainer. The answer is simple– swim every day so that your endurance improves. Do this activity for a minimum of 20 minutes to reap all the benefits it offers.

Once you make it a habit, your body will receive more oxygen as it works out your lungs. As you become a master of this activity, you can increase the duration.

7. High-intensity Interval Training or HIIT

HIIT is a versatile exercise method and can fit into any workout routine. It can be cardio, weight lifting, free-hand exercises etc. It’s a proven method for increasing stamina as it helps increase the energy pool in our body, which helps increase stamina.

The way to do a HIIT workout is:

  • First, do an exercise for 20 seconds.
  • Then, do another set of exercises for 20 seconds.
  • Rest for 20 seconds.

If you repeat this procedure for 30–40 minutes 3-4 times a week, the stamina will increase drastically.

Point to Remember

If you repeat the same kind of exercise every day for weeks, your stamina will not increase. Therefore, you need to bring changes in your exercise routine and the types of activities. In addition, the duration also needs to grow slowly and gradually for optimum stamina gain. For example, given below is a 5-day work-out routine:

  • Aerobic exercises with HIIT
  • Weight lifting
  • Cycling with HIIT (fast cycling for a min and then slow for 2 minutes)
  • Aerobic exercises with HIIT
  • Weight lifting

Keep two days of the week to rest and repair your muscles.

Best Foods to Increase Stamina

In the topic of how to increase stamina by food, add the following options to your meals:

1. Bananas

When it comes to improving your stamina, you need to snack only on suitable foods.

Bananas are always an excellent option, as they provide high amounts of energy. In addition, every serving will give you nutrients like vitamin B6, potassium, carbohydrates, fibre, fats, and protein.

Make sure you snack on this before you do the above exercises.

2. Brown rice

If you have the habit of eating white rice, you should switch to its brown variant. Due to the lower amounts of processing, you will get more nutrients from the food.

In addition, complex carbohydrates are the key to better stamina. It takes longer for your body to break down brown rice, ensuring you have energy throughout the day.

You will get manganese, protein, fat, fibre, carbohydrates, iron, magnesium, phosphorus, and selenium with every serving. 

3. Coffee

Are you someone who can’t start the day without a cup of coffee? Then, you can continue the habit if you are looking to increase your stamina. Owing to its high caffeine content, coffee helps boost your energy.

In addition, as it stimulates the brain and your body, you will find it easier to focus. The best part is that a single cup of black coffee contains only two calories.

As it stimulates the brain and your body, you will find it easier to focus. The best part is that if you have a single cup of black coffee, it only contains two calories.

A cup of coffee everyday can help improve stamina

4. Eggs and Chicken

Eggs are an excellent food to add to your diet because of the amount of energy they provide. Every serving gives you high amounts of carbohydrates. As a result, you will have ample amounts of energy, which will help increase your stamina.

Also, leucine, a type of amino acid, enhances energy production in your body. It increases the rate of fat breakdown, which increases your stamina. Eggs are also a great source of vitamin B, making it easier for your body to break down food.

Chicken is a source of white meat, which is widely available everywhere. It is abundant in protein. In addition, it has a versatile nature, and you can incorporate it into a variety of foods. The protein from chicken is biologically active and digests quickly in the human body.

5. Fish

Adding fish to your diet is a must, as it is one of the best foods to increase stamina. It contains high amounts of omega-3 fatty acids, vital for your brain and body. In addition, tuna and salmon contain DHA and EPA, two fatty acids essential for improving your endurance.

Every serving of either of these types of fish will give you vitamin B12 and protein. When you experience fatigue, there will be inflammation in your body. The omega-3 fatty acids reduce this issue, allowing you to get back up on your feet faster.

These food types have high amounts of carbohydrates, protein, fibre, and fat. As a result, they bring down the amount of energy your body releases. The benefit of this process is that you will observe a significant improvement in your stamina. Also, they provide a variety of nutrients, which are great for your well-being.

Foods to Avoid to Increase Stamina

While touching on the subject of how to increase stamina by food, avoid the following options:

1. Alcohol

Alcohol is a strict no-no if you look to improve your stamina levels. Alcoholic beverages are well known for decreasing your endurance during workouts. For the activation and coordination of the muscle fibres, you need your nervous system.

The problem with alcohol is that it slows down this part of your body. You will experience dehydration, which will last through the next day, post the drinking session. If you are going to hit the gym, ensure you don’t consume alcohol.

Say no to alcohol

2. Fried food

Fried foods are popular because they are delicious. However, if you want to increase stamina, you should stay away from it. Your body takes longer to digest fried foods due to their high-fat content. Hence, you should never consume them before a workout.

Make sure you avoid having fried foods the night before you go to the gym or decide to exercise. The reason is that you tend to feel lethargic after consuming them.

3. Milk

Before you hit the gym, you should give every dairy-based product a pass. The reason is that the sugar present in this food takes longer to digest. As a result, you can suffer from indigestion if you aren’t careful. Also, it leaves an unpleasant coating in your mouth, which becomes apparent when you work out.

That said, milk is a good source of protein and can help improve your overall stamina. However, you should avoid milk only before you hit the gym.

Drinking milk before a workout can reduce one's stamina levels

Vital Elements to Increase Stamina


Hydration is a crucial element when you are trying to increase stamina. Proper water intake is vital for every individual to function smoothly. Post-workout water consumption should be adequate and regular. It is very beneficial for increasing stamina.


Repair and rest are essential after every exercise routine or workout. The wear and tear of muscles happens when we work out. For our muscles to have strength, we need proper sleep. It helps repair the muscles and make them function smoothly.


When the goal is to increase stamina, make sure that you follow the instructions in this guide. The trick is to combine exercise with healthy food options, ensuring you get the best of both worlds. When it comes to physical activity, make sure you do the exercises regularly. However, you must give your body adequate time to recover. In addition, make sure you hydrate yourself, which allows you to push your body for more extended periods.

While it is important to rest between each exercise, try to reduce the duration of the downtime. By increasing the level of exertion slowly, you will understand the tricks and techniques to increase your stamina.

Remember, the journey to increase your stamina naturally is a marathon, not a 100-metre dash!

Frequently Asked Questions (FAQs)

Q1. Which foods can help increase stamina?

A: Ideally, ensure that you consume a combination of carbs and protein. Fruits like banana and apple, along with whole wheat bread, brown rice and whole oats, will go a long way in improving your stamina. In addition to these foods, you can also include nuts like almonds, figs, walnuts and peanuts in your diet.

Q2. How long does it take to increase stamina?

A: The time it takes to increase your stamina may vary based on the consistency of your efforts concerning diet and exercise. However, you should ideally see improvements in 3 months.

Q3. Which juice is good for your stamina?

A: Beetroot juice, Melon Papaya Juice, Kale and Apple Juice are some of the juices that are known to increase stamina. 

Q4. How can I get instant energy?

A: Consuming the following foods are some of the ways you can receive instant energy:

  • Banana
  • Black coffee
  • Apples
  • Oats with milk and honey

Q5. How can I increase my stamina naturally?

A: Regular exercise routine, proper diet, sleep and water intake can help in increasing stamina naturally.

Q6. Which food is high in stamina?

A: There is no food high in stamina. However, protein-rich foods help increase muscle mass which in turn help to increase muscle strength and stamina.

Q7.  What causes poor stamina?

A: Improper diet, faulty or no exercise routine cause poor stamina.

Q8. Which fruit is best for stamina?

A: After a workout, a banana gives good energy and essential vitamins and minerals.

Q9. What foods decrease stamina?

A: Fried and fatty foods decrease stamina.

Q10. What food gives immediate energy?

A: Fruits give instant energy and are from a natural source.

Q11. What is the best vitamin for stamina?

A: Vitamin B complex is essential for stamina building.

Q12. What exercises increase stamina?

A: A combination of different types of exercise, with an increase in duration day by day, help in increasing stamina.

About the Author

The holder of a Bachelor’s Degree in Naturopathy and Yogic Sciences, Dr. Priyanka has more than 7 years of experience in the field of health and wellness. Currently serving as a Sr. Nutritionist at HealthifyMe, she specializes in Weight Management, Lifestyle Modifications, and PCOS, Diabetes, and Cholesterol Management. In addition to being a Nutritionist, Dr. Priyanka is also a Fitness Enthusiast and a certified Zumba instructor. A strong believer in eating healthy, she is certain that the right kind of motivation can help an individual work wonders in their lives.

